The US Digital Health For Cardiovascular Care market size was valued at approximately USD 4.5 billion in 2025 and is projected to reach USD 12.8 billion by 2035, growing at a CAGR of 9.8% during the forecast period. This market encompasses digital health solutions aimed at improving cardiovascular care, which include remote monitoring devices, telemedicine platforms, ECG and heart rate monitoring technologies, and mobile applications focused on heart health. The segmentation by product type is essential as it addresses varying clinical and patient needs through distinct technological solutions. The commercial importance of each product type drives investment and innovation within this category, capturing diverse end-user demands and healthcare provider adoption rates.
Remote Monitoring Devices β 40%: Remote monitoring devices account for the largest share due to their critical role in managing chronic cardiovascular conditions with continuous patient data tracking capabilities.
Telemedicine Platforms β 35%: Telemedicine platforms are gaining significant traction as they offer convenient access to cardiovascular care, thereby maintaining a considerable market share.
Mobile Health Apps β 25%: Mobile health apps contribute notably by promoting preventive care and lifestyle management through user-friendly interfaces and real-time health tracking features.

Heart Rate Monitoring β 45%: Heart rate monitoring commands the largest contribution within applications due to its fundamental role in cardiovascular diagnostics and continuous patient evaluation.
ECG Monitoring β 35%: ECG monitoring holds a substantial share, reflecting its widespread adoption as a diagnostic tool supporting critical clinical insights and patient management.
Blood Pressure Monitoring β 20%: Blood pressure monitoring remains vital in the application category, owing to its importance in preventive cardiology and monitoring hypertension risks.

The regulatory landscape plays a pivotal role in shaping market dynamics, with policies like The Affordable Care Act and The Health Information Technology for Economic and Clinical Health (HITECH) Act facilitating market adoption and compliance strategies. Industry standards are evolving to manage cybersecurity risks, impacting entry barriers, while promoting technological innovation and competitive parity. Compliance with data privacy laws such as HIPAA is essential to navigate competition and foster technological progression within regulatory frameworks.
The market is moderately consolidated with key players like Philips Healthcare, Medtronic, and Abbott establishing significant footholds through expansive product portfolios and strategic geographies.
